Information analytics engineer: Defining the purpose and ability prerequisites

Were being you not able to show up at Renovate 2022? Verify out all of the summit periods in our on-desire library now! Check out here.

As substantial amounts of information, from equally external and inside details sources, have turn into central to jogging an business, a pipeline of specialized staffing roles has been formulated to manage the assortment and processing of that information.

Down in the engine home, if you will, is a facts engineer who integrates many resources of info and manages the functions that make and keep the information accessible for business assessment. 

On the top rated deck is the info analyst, who serves the data from largely pre-fashioned models to nontechnical company customers so they can execute their perform.

Mid-deck, between these two, is the knowledge analytics engineer. This is a expert who understands equally info engineering technology and the knowledge assessment desires of a company, and so can establish the analytical styles that the higher-deck details analysts and company conclude customers require to fulfill their roles. 


MetaBeat 2022

MetaBeat will carry jointly thought leaders to give direction on how metaverse technological know-how will rework the way all industries connect and do organization on October 4 in San Francisco, CA.

Sign up Below

As a result, a knowledge analytics engineer is a particular person who combines the capabilities of the info analyst and computer software engineer to source and change facts for easy assessment. Mainly because of their specialized dexterity and company acumen, they have turn into quite precious as associates of the details crew. This short article information the duties and requisite competencies of the analytics engineer, as well as the remuneration prospective clients of the job.

Who is a info analytics engineer?

The analytics engineer is a member of a knowledge staff who is accountable for productive, built-in data types and solutions. They construct handy, well-tested and documented dataset representations and resources that the relaxation of the firm can use to respond to their thoughts. 

They go and renovate info from the source so that it can be effortlessly analyzed, visualized and worked on by the data analyst or small business user. Not only that, but they have the technical techniques to utilize computer software engineering best practices this sort of as Edition Handle and CI/CD, but also require to communicate efficiently with stakeholders about the use of these equipment.

The datasets made by a details analytics engineer enable finish-customers to comprehend and analyze the data within just the details. An analytics engineer combines organization system and technical info awareness to translate intricate facts and illustrate them plainly as visual representations known as facts versions. They collaborate with details analysts and details engineers to supply very simple visual representations of data patterns and communicate their which means to coworkers, stakeholders and conclusion-users.

The changeover to cloud data warehouses, evolution of self-services small business intelligence (BI) instruments and introduction of info ingestion resources have contributed to considerable shifts in info tooling. Roles and duties inside traditional data teams are modifying.

With the change to an extract, load, change (ELT) method, information now drops in the warehouse before it has been transformed. This creates an option for expert complex analysts who are both  well-versed with the business and the technological skills needed to model the raw information into neat, well-outlined datasets. This necessitates the techniques of both a software program engineer and a info analyst, which the analytics engineer possesses.

Analytics engineers deal with the facts itself, as perfectly as managing and sorting data. It is their occupation to make confident info is ingested, reworked, scheduled and prepared to be utilized for analytics by all who may possibly need it. A lot of analytics engineers are the orchestrators of the contemporary data stack, and they determine on and implement equipment for ETL/ELT.

Purpose of a details analytics engineer

The analytics engineer is responsible for applying and controlling a details warehouse to ingest information. They also determine on the very best instruments to ingest knowledge from different sources into this warehouse. Then they model the data to be utilized by analysts and plan checks to simplify these models. The basic obligations of the analytics engineer involve:

1. Knowledge warehouse administration

Engineers are responsible for ingesting knowledge into the warehouse and creating sure that datasets are taken care of. They are the very first to be notified of any difficulty in the pipeline, so they can resolve it.

2. Data modeling

This is the course of action of making visible representations of data and relating connections in between different info places and methods. Analytics engineers are billed with modeling raw details into datasets that allow analytics throughout the company. These datasets act as a central supply of truth, producing it easier for organization analysts and other stakeholders to watch and realize facts in a databases.

3. Info orchestration

The engineer makes details pipelines and workflows to transfer info from one stage to a further, and coordinates the combining, verifying and storing of that information for analysis. The engineer understands anything about knowledge orchestration and automation.

4. Placing very best procedures

They allow other staff customers like details analysts and information scientists to be much more successful. No matter whether by sharing ideas for writing greater SQL, remodeling a dataset to consist of a new metric or dimension, or education them on how to implement most effective tactics for program engineering. This strategy is referred to as dataops (a methodology that integrates facts engineering, knowledge analytics and devops). A few finest practices that can be optimized involve model control, facts unit screening as well as continual integration and ongoing delivery (CI/CD).

5. Inter-collaboration

As a member of a group, they collaborate with crew associates to obtain enterprise needs, define effective analytics outcomes and layout facts types.

Depending on the firm and job technical specs, a information analytic engineer may perhaps be essential to execute some or all of the pursuing:

  • Collaborate with solution, engineering, knowledge science, method and client teams to have an understanding of customer demands and provide actionable options.
  • Remodel raw knowledge into actionable analytical info and business enterprise logic.
  • Interface instantly with other engagement teams to current analyses to reply their important organization concerns.
  • Merge facts mastery with field abilities to scope and put into practice jobs applying relevant datasets.
  • Find parts for functional advancement and choose initiative to acceptable them.
  • Present sophisticated evaluation, insights and data-pushed suggestions to interior groups and other anxious stakeholders.

The analytics engineer collects info, patterns facts products, writes code, maintains details documentation, collaborates with details group associates and communicates success to anxious stakeholders. Thus, the Analytics Engineer blends company acumen with technological experience and alternates among small business system and facts growth.

Vital skill necessities to be successful in 2022

Each and every organization or employer appears out for a precise set of techniques that they call for in an analytics engineer, but some standard skills and competencies are crucial for each and every analytics engineer. These competencies are mentioned subsequently.

SQL and DBT Prowess

Analytic engineers generally use SQL to publish transformations within data styles. SQL is one of the most important expertise that you want to learn to grow to be an analytics engineer, considering the fact that the important portion of the analytics engineer’s responsibilities is developing logic for knowledge transformations, producing queries and making facts types. 

SQL is carefully connected to Dbt in the language it utilizes, so understanding of the previous is needed for the latter. Dbt is the main info transformation instrument in the field, which is why it is most probable that the the vast majority of analytics engineers use this to create their knowledge styles.

Programming languages

Information of state-of-the-art languages like R and Python is very important for analytics engineers to handle several information orchestration jobs. Lots of info pipeline applications employ Python, and recognizing how to code in it is extremely valuable for crafting your individual pipeline as an engineer.

Contemporary info stack applications

An analytics engineer wants to be conversant with the most popular resources in a contemporary facts stack. This means possessing knowledge with ingestion, transformation, warehousing and deployment equipment: if not in depth understanding of them, then at least the essential principles driving each individual of them. Finding out just one software in each and every part of the stack might aid inferential knowing of the other people.

Knowledge engineering and BI resources knowledge

An engineer requirements to have encounter with tools for setting up information pipelines. Some of these equipment involve data warehouses like Snowflake, Amazon Redshift and Google BigQuery ETL applications like AWS Glue, Talend, or others — as nicely as small business intelligence tools like Tableau, Looker, and so forth.

Conversation and interpersonal techniques

Interaction is important for analytics engineers for the reason that it is their obligation to guarantee that anyone is current on the standing of info. They need to have to converse with related persons when info high quality is compromised or when a pipeline is ruined, to fully grasp what the enterprise desires. They also want to collaborate with organization teams and data analysts to fully grasp what the small business wants. If this isn’t finished, erroneous assumptions can be manufactured on faulty info, and valuable concepts and chances will go unnoticed. It is very important for an analytics engineer to acquire and sustain multi-purposeful interactions with several groups throughout the enterprise.

In sum, an analytics engineer have to have a sturdy mixture of complex dexterity and stakeholder management skills to realize success.

Income variety

Analytics engineers in all industries and environments now have fantastic potential clients with good remuneration scales. In accordance to Glassdoor, the normal foundation income is $91,188 and $111,038 in total on a yearly basis in the U.S.

Summary/Important takeaways

The analytics engineer is tasked with modeling data to supply neat and exact datasets so that distinctive customers inside of and outside the house the corporation can realize and employ them. The role involves accumulating, reworking, screening and documenting details. It involves critical abilities in conditions of interaction, software program engineering and programming.

The role of the analytics engineer is reasonably new to the data analytics area of interest, but it is quick attaining traction and recognition as extra and a lot more folks realize its truly worth.

VentureBeat’s mission is to be a digital town square for technological final decision-makers to obtain understanding about transformative organization technology and transact. Discover our Briefings.

Resource :

Leave a Comment

SMM Panel PDF Kitap indir